Bias and Fairness Issues
The integration of artificial intelligence into various sectors has heightened awareness of bias and fairness issues that can arise during AI development. Algorithmic transparency is essential to mitigate discriminatory outcomes stemming from implicit biases. Implementing accountability frameworks and diversity metrics can enhance data representation, fostering social equity through fairness assessments.
Aspect | Importance | Solutions |
---|---|---|
Algorithmic Transparency | Reduces bias | Open-source algorithms |
Data Representation | Ensures fairness | Diverse training datasets |
Accountability | Promotes ethical AI use | Regular audits |
Key Ethical Challenges in Artificial Intelligence
As artificial intelligence systems increasingly integrate into various aspects of society, a range of ethical challenges emerges that demands careful consideration.
Key issues include:
- Algorithmic transparency
- Moral responsibility of developers
- Data privacy concerns
- Accountability for AI decisions
- Potential job displacement
These challenges require a nuanced understanding to ensure that AI technologies uphold societal values and respect individual freedoms while navigating complex moral landscapes.

Establishing Ethical Guidelines
Although the rapid advancement of artificial intelligence presents significant opportunities, it simultaneously raises complex ethical dilemmas that necessitate the establishment of robust guidelines.
Effective ethical frameworks should encompass:
- Transparency in AI decision-making
- Fairness and non-discrimination
- Accountability in AI deployment
- Respect for user privacy
- Alignment with moral philosophies that prioritize human welfare
Such guidelines are essential to navigate the evolving landscape of AI ethics.
